The Top Three Reasons to Get Rid of Your Emotional Clutter

Just as most of us have physical clutter in our lives from time to time (or all the time); most of us have emotional clutter as well. Emotional clutter consists of negative emotions and self-limiting beliefs that we have hung on to long after they have outlived their usefulness. Just like physical clutter, we stockpile it because of the mistaken belief that it is important to keep. We think it will remind us of some important experience or life lesson.
Unfortunately, more often than not, emotional clutter just clutters up our lives and sabotages our dreams. The top three reasons for clearing out all that emotional clutter:
1. You can then find and use your resources.
Just as physical clutter blocks your ability to see where you have put your car keys or that important paper, emotional clutter blocks your ability to see the resources you have available to you to be successful, solve problems and create the sort of life you'd like to be living.
Getting rid of emotional clutter allows you to see what resources you have available to utilize in your life. Those resources consist of your talents, your gifts, and your unique abilities. When you can clearly see your resources, it is easier to use them both more effectively and more efficiently.
2. You can overcome limitations.
When you get rid of emotional clutter, you are able to overcome your limitations. Most of the limitations we place on ourselves have nothing to do with realityBthey are limitations we have created from our beliefs or fears of failure.
Getting rid of emotional clutter allows you to overcome those limitations that are really simply limitations in your thinking. When you believe you can do something, you can. Imagine what you could accomplish if you absolutely believed you could not fail.
3. You can get unstuck and move forward.
Emotional clutter is the leading cause of being STUCK in your life or your business. When you are stuck, you are stopped from moving forward. You may expend plenty of energy, but you are treading water.
Negative emotions from the past keep you stuck because of the fear that you will re-experience similar situations with a similar emotional impact. That inventory of bad experiences is nothing more than emotional clutter, which, if you hold on to it, will keep you stuck.
Getting rid of emotional clutter allows you to put past experiences behind you. Once you get the positive learning from them, you are able to move on. There is no need for you to hang on to emotions or limiting beliefs from the past. When you rid yourself of emotional clutter, you can more clearly see your options, and have more choices. This allows you to move toward a life of greater happiness and success. nn(c) 2009 Linda S. Pucci, Ph.D.
